The Terreaux square lies in central Lyon between the Saone and Rhone rivers. On its east side it is bordered by the city hall (hotel de ville) built between 1645 and 1651 by Simon Maupin. On the south side is the museum of fine arts in the palais Saint-Pierre. On the square is the Bartholdi fountain built by Frédéric Auguste Bartholdi in 1891.
